SEOUL (Reuters) - South Korea's two major airlines said on Friday they had stopped flying over Ukraine air space since March 3 because of security concerns.
Korean Air Lines Co Ltd and Asiana Airlines Inc both said they had changed flight paths to avoid flying over Ukraine since the same date.
